What exactly happened to Stella’s friend Ricki in Fate: The Winx Saga season 1? The ill-fated character doesn’t appear on camera yet she’s repeatedly mentioned by name. To its credit, the Netflix series does explain the basics of Stella’s friendship with Ricki, however, a twist involving Queen Luna complicates the subplot.

In Fate: The Winx Saga season 1, Stella (Hannah van der Westhuysen) is immediately positioned as a privileged student at Alfea College. Upon meeting the series, protagonist, Bloom (Abigail Cowen), the character reveals she has a getaway ring, a family heirloom that will allow her to escape the Otherworld if life gets too difficult. The rest of the fairies at Alfea College are told to “trust the process” by headmistress Farah Dowling (Eve Best), but it seems Stella has a license to flee if need be. Bloom eventually discovers that not only is Stella the actual Princess of Solaria, the daughter of Queen Luna (Kate Fleetwood), but she’s also the ex-girlfriend of a “legacy admission” named Sky (Danny Griffin) who is the son of a legendary fallen soldier named Andreas of Eraklyon. During the opening episodes of Fate: The Winx Saga season 1, Stella is very much framed as a Mean Girl, someone who will challenge Bloom throughout the series.

The third episode of Fate: The Wing Saga season 1, “Heavy Mortal Hopes,” further positions Stella as someone with questionable motivations regarding Ricki. At the annual specialists’ party, Sky implies it doesn’t matter what people think about Stella, who subsequently makes a cryptic statement about her mysterious friend, noting “what people think with Ricki IS what happened.” Sky then acknowledges a conversation between Riven (Freddie Thorp) and Bloom in which it was revealed Stella purposely blinded her former best friend, Ricki. What neither Stella or Sky realize, however, is that they’ve both been manipulated by Queen Luna, who seemingly has information about Ricki’s whereabouts.

The fifth episode of Fate: The Winx Saga season 1 acknowledges what really happened to Ricki. In one conversation, Farah confronts Queen Luna about the lack of available troops and wonders if it’s because she “failed” to “rehabilitate” Stella. As it turns out, Queen Luna manipulated her daughter into believing that she had to prioritize negative emotions, which unsurprisingly had a negative effect on Stella’s frame of mind. The princess’ subsequent lack of control over her powers led to the inadvertent blinding of her best friend, Ricki. Unfortunately, Fate: The Winx Saga season 1 doesn’t fully explore this subplot, perhaps because it will become a more prominent storyline in the second installment.

Online, it’s been suggested by fans (via Reddit) that the mysterious Ricki in Fate: The Winx Saga season 1 could actually be Tecna from the original Winx cartoon. For one, the character was a founding member of the Winx Club, which suggests she’d at least be referenced by name. So, when considering magic is such a key component in the Netflix series, and that characters like Bloom and Stella are continuously learning how to develop their powers, it seems plausible that animated characters such as Tecna and Flora may be part of future installments. Fate: The Winx Saga season 1 ends with Rosalind (Lesley Sharp) forming an alliance with Queen Luna and killing Farah, so future episodes will presumably show Bloom and Stella teaming up for a rebellion at Alfea College, which would allow for more clarity about the Ricki storyline.
